I've been lurking around this one random generator site, Seventh Sanctum ( [link] ), for quite some time now and they hold contests every so often where basically the idea is that you have to use one of the generators and draw or write something based on your results from the generator. I've never entered one of the competitions before (mostly because I'm lazy), but the current one looked like fun so I decided to do something for it. This particular contest could probably be summed up simply as "draw a pretty person-thing" and since two entries per person are allowed I thought I might as well go with a gimick and put two in one (because, honestly, what makes one bishonen look prettier than another bishonen?).

Anyway, I ended up using results from the "Fangirl Fantasy Fufiller" generator which were as follows:

"This artist experiences gender confusion (but doesn't seem to suffer from it). His silky hair is the color of desert sand. His mysterious eyes are like two setting suns. When he speaks, he speaks each word dramatically and clearly."

"This teacher is cool and elegant. His scarlet eyes have a hyptonic quality you can't resist. His ash-gray hair is bound by a single black ribbon. He tends to speak in short sentances."
